The Journey of Artificial Intelligence: From Imagination to Reality
Artificial Intelligence (AI) began as a simple human dream to create machines that could think, learn, and make decisions like humans. In the early days of computing, scientists imagined a future where machines would not just follow instructions but also understand information and solve problems on their own. This idea sounded almost impossible at the time, but it laid the foundation for one of the most powerful technologies in history.
In the 1950s, Artificial Intelligence officially became a field of study in computer science. Researchers believed that human intelligence could be replicated using mathematical logic and code. Early AI systems were very basic and could only perform limited tasks, such as solving simple equations or playing logical games. Although these systems were not advanced, they represented the first step toward intelligent machines.
As technology improved, computers became faster and more powerful. This allowed researchers to develop better algorithms that could process more data. Over time, a new concept called Machine Learning emerged. Instead of manually programming every rule, machines were now able to learn from data and improve their performance automatically. This was a major breakthrough because it allowed systems to adapt and evolve over time.
With the growth of the internet, massive amounts of data became available. This data became the fuel for AI systems. Companies started using machine learning to analyze user behavior, recommend products, and improve services. Slowly, AI started entering everyday life without people even realizing it. Search engines became smarter, social media platforms began showing personalized content, and online shopping experiences became more efficient.
The next major evolution came with voice assistants like Siri and Alexa. These systems could understand human speech and respond intelligently. This was made possible through Natural Language Processing, a branch of AI that focuses on understanding human language. For the first time, humans could communicate with machines in a more natural way.
Later, Deep Learning took AI to an even higher level. Inspired by the structure of the human brain, neural networks allowed machines to recognize images, understand speech, and even translate languages. Self-driving cars, facial recognition systems, and smart cameras became real applications of this technology. AI was no longer just a concept; it had become part of real-world systems.
AI also started transforming industries like healthcare, education, and business. In healthcare, AI helped doctors detect diseases earlier and more accurately. In education, it created personalized learning systems for students. In business, AI automated repetitive tasks, improved decision-making, and increased productivity. This made organizations more efficient and competitive.
As AI continued to grow, it also entered creative fields. It began generating music, writing articles, and creating digital art. Tools like ChatGPT introduced a new era of Generative AI, where machines could produce human-like content. This changed the way people worked, learned, and communicated.
However, with great power came important challenges. Many people started worrying about job displacement, privacy, and the ethical use of AI. Governments and organizations began discussing regulations to ensure AI is used responsibly. Researchers also focused on making AI systems transparent, fair, and safe for everyone.
Despite these concerns, AI continues to evolve at an incredible speed. Today, it is used in almost every industry, from finance and cybersecurity to entertainment and transportation. Smartphones, websites, and applications all rely on AI to provide better user experiences. Businesses use AI to predict trends, improve marketing, and understand customers more deeply.
The future of Artificial Intelligence is even more exciting. Scientists are working toward Artificial General Intelligence (AGI), where machines will be able to think and reason like humans across all tasks. Although this goal is still in development, it represents the next big milestone in technology.
What makes AI truly powerful is not just the technology itself, but how humans choose to use it. If used responsibly, AI has the potential to solve some of the world’s biggest problems, including healthcare challenges, climate change, and education gaps. However, it is important that humans remain in control and guide its development carefully.
The journey of Artificial Intelligence is still in its early stages. From simple mathematical logic to advanced generative models, AI has already changed the world in ways that were once unimaginable. As we move forward, AI will continue to grow, evolve, and reshape human life in every possible way. The future is not just about machines becoming smarter, but about humans and machines working together to build a better world.
